Receiving a personalised mug is great. For those who have the time and artistic flair to make beautiful mugs themselves, follow the following guidelines to help you make a memorable mug for those close to you:
o Wash and dry your mug and wipe it down with a cotton ball soaked in rubbing alcohol, which removes any residual oil from the mug. O Paint a design, picture or logo onto your mug. O Bake the mug in an oven at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 30 minutes. O Let the mug cool inside the oven. O Wash and dry the mug before using it.
Photo and logo personalised mugs (when ordered online): o Decide on the photo and log; use high quality pictures o Use a website that gives you the option to customise your design o Follow the instructions on uploading and customizing information o Look at shipping costs and refund policy, as well as time frame for delivery
Make personalised mugs even more personal; do it yourself.

Maybe you have a washing machine, and maybe even a tumble dryer too, or at least a clothes line or clothes rack that you can put up outside or indoors. Perhaps you may even have invested in a dehumidifier to help dry your clothes indoors overnight, especially common if you are short on space, for example if you live in a flat in central London. Maybe you do not have access to any of those items and just use the nearest launderette. So why would you need a Dry Cleaners in London?
Chances are you have some extra special clothing tucked away in your wardrobe for the not so often dressy occasions such as weddings and high class summer parties! Those items are usually dry clean only, which means that the fabrics and material construction are not suitable for washing by hand or by conventional washing machine. The soaking and spinning action will most likely damage the items.
Ladies items that may need to be washed include long dresses, any outerwear made of silk, skirts, knitwear, wedding dresses, ballgowns and coats. From the gents side, woolen items, suits, trousers, jackets and blazers, overcoats, hats, shirts and silk ties. Items such as wax jackets, leather and suede, fur clothing, specialist clothes such as dog collars and barristers bands, cumberbunds and cravats all require the special attention of a dry cleaning outfit.
Setting domestic rationales aside for a second, businesses will likely have the need for a regular dry cleaning contract too. From office and boardroom linen, through to uniforms and convenience software such as hand towels, dry cleaners will be able to arrange weekly cleaning.
Catering for general cleaning and specialist stain removal on clothing items, most dry cleaners will also offer a service for bed linen, including duvets, pillows and bolsters which rarely fit in standard domestic washing appliances. Similarly, furnishings such as curtains and drapes, nets and blinds all fall into the dry clean only category. Many dry cleaners will clean loose carpets and rugs too, even catering for antique items in some cases.
Some dry cleaning establishments will offer a number of added value services to compliment the actual cleaning. These add ons can range from simply collection and drop off of your items, through to re sizing and alterations of your clothes, fitting new zips and repairing hems, adjusting waists and shortening or lengthening dresses and trousers.
